    Thanks for posting these, crabbyman!
    The settings available on any particular car are determined dynamically by the app based on what the car supports. There are a total of 100+ settings, but a Gen3 Prius usually supports around 30-40 of them. The next version of Carista will add about 20-30 more settings in total (not necessarily specific to the Prius). Note that even within the Gen3 Prii, there are differences in the available customizations, depending on the year, specific model, and factory-installed options.

    I have purposefully not added the seatbelt chime setting because I'm not sure yet whether there are any legal requirements about that... so I don't want to be liable or break any laws. Need to consult with a lawyer. Plus, the reminder chime seems like a good thing to have, given that seatbelts are indeed proven to be effective in cases of accidents.

    It's free to see what settings are available for your car in Carista. So just try it :) You only have to pay if you want to change something. That said, I don't remember seeing anything about adjusting the speedo. There might be something related to MPG in the next version, but I'm not sure yet.

    We're in the process of adding more settings. Basically, if a dealer can do it, Carista should be able to do it as well (for supported models only - we don't support the older communication protocol used by Toyotas until 2006, and for some models even later - e.g. the Gen2 Prius).

    Btw, if you guys also have other 2006+ Toyota/Lexus/Scion cars besides the Prius, it would be of huge help if you could send me a "debug report" that contains info about supported settings. To do that, open the slide-out menu from the left and tap on the "Version 2.0" label 5 times. This will open a new screen that collects info and then guides you to sending a report. Please include the exact year and model of the car. Thanks!
